Dhurandhar Returns to Cinemas Worldwide as Anticipation Builds for Dhurandhar: The Revenge

Excitement for the Dhurandhar franchise is soaring as the original film makes a rare international theatrical comeback ahead of its sequel’s release. Supported by Jio Studios and B62 Studios, the global blockbuster Dhurandhar is being re-released worldwide, ramping up momentum for Dhurandhar: The Revenge, which premieres on March 19, 2026.The re-release kicked off in India on March 12, screening on approximately 250 screens, and is expanding overseas from March 13 with an additional 250 screens. Altogether, the film will be shown on around 500 screens globally, giving audiences a chance to relive the action-packed spy thriller on the big screen before diving into the next chapter.
For fans, this offers a unique opportunity to watch the original just days before the sequel hits theatres, allowing a thrilling back-to-back viewing experience that rekindles the excitement that made Dhurandhar a major cinematic event. International re-releases of Hindi films are rare, underscoring the franchise’s strong global appeal, particularly in markets like North America where it returns to nearly 185 screens.
Adding to the buzz, Dhurandhar: The Revenge will hold special Wednesday premiere shows across the United States and Canada on March 18, a day ahead of the worldwide release. Many screenings will be on Premium Large Format (PLF) screens featuring immersive Dolby Atmos sound, expansive wall-to-wall visuals, enhanced projection, and luxury seating formats usually reserved for major Hollywood releases.
Early reports show several of these premieres are already sold out.The recently unveiled trailer has generated significant excitement among audiences and industry insiders, with trade analysts and exhibitors predicting a strong international run. Bringing the first film back to cinemas just before the sequel’s release has further amplified fan enthusiasm.
Presented by Jio Studios and produced by B62 Studios, Dhurandhar: The Revenge is written, directed, and produced by Aditya Dhar, with Jyoti Deshpande and Lokesh Dhar also producing. This high-octane spy-action thriller will release worldwide in five languages—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am, and Kannada.The film’s release aligns with festive occasions like Gudi Padwa, Ugadi, and the lead-up to Eid al-Fitr, setting the stage for the Dhurandhar saga to captivate audiences around the globe once again.
